Free shipping for many products! WebThe standard ECG – which is referred to as a 12-lead ECG since it includes 12 leads – is obtained using 10 electrodes. These 12 leads consists of two sets of ECG leads: limb leads and chest leads. The chest leads may also be referred to as precordial leads . The PR interval is the time from the onset of the P wave to the start of the QRS complex. It reflects conduction through the AV node. The normal PR interval is between 120 – 200 ms (0.12-0.20s) in duration (three to five small squares). Performed while you are lying still, this EKG records your … Web18 jun. 2024 · The 12RL™ technology provides 12-lead view, 12-lead ST monitoring and global QT/QTc interval measurement using a reduced leadset. It means only six electrodes in standard placement (RA, RL, LA, LL, V1 and V5) are required. Precordial electrodes V2, V3, V4, and V6 are not needed. WebAn ECG involves attaching 10 electrical cables to the body: one to each limb and six across the chest. ECG terminology has two meanings for the word "lead": the cable used to connect an electrode to the ECG recorder. the electrical view of the heart obtained from any one combination of electrodes. Web7 apr. 2024 · If people spot an extra beat in a short (15-second) ECG recording, they shouldn’t panic, Dr. Orini said. "In most cases, these extra beats are benign and do not represent an imminent risk," he said.
